Jakarta, CNBC Indonesia – The Nationwide Investigation Workplace of the Korean Nationwide Police Company is investigating 193 circumstances ghost kids or a ghost child. Ghost kids known as the beginning of a child who has by no means been registered with the native authorities.
The issue is, these infants should not solely not registered within the civil registry, however a few of them have mysteriously died.
Launch Korea Heraldpolice has acquired 209 experiences of unregistered infants till Tuesday (4/7/2023). From a complete of 209 circumstances, 11 unregistered infants have been discovered lifeless.
The Gyeonggi Nambu Provincial Police are at the moment investigating 4 of those 11 suspicious deaths. Police added that they have been dashing up their investigation to seek out one other 178 anonymous newborns.
The start of the ‘ghost child’ case in Korea
This ‘ghost child’ case got here to gentle after many homicide circumstances involving undocumented infants.
Late final month, two infants have been discovered lifeless in a fridge at a residence in Suwon, Gyeonggi Province. The mom was arrested for infanticide and later referred to prosecutors on expenses of homicide and hiding the physique.
Whereas Suwon’s case remains to be underneath investigation, one other unregistered child boy was discovered lifeless and buried in Geoje, South Gyeongsang Province, in the identical interval.
A lady in her 20s was additionally arrested for letting her child starve to demise.
In one other case, a lady in her 20s dwelling in Hwaseong, Gyeonggi Province, was detained by police on suspicion of handing over her new child child to an unknown particular person she met by social media after giving beginning in December 2021.
The Busan Metropolitan Police mentioned they have been investigating a lady for allegedly leaving her child within the hills round her dwelling after giving beginning in February 2015. Nevertheless, the girl was not charged underneath the statute of limitations of seven years for the crime.
In the meantime, a June report issued by the Board of Audit and Inspection discovered that not less than 2,236 newborns born in medical establishments have been unregistered from 2015 to 2022.
In response to guidelines in South Korea, solely dad and mom are required to register their kid’s beginning with the federal government inside one month after beginning.
However not too long ago, the Nationwide Meeting handed a revision to the Legislation on Registration of Household Relations which required employees in medical establishments to report newborns to native governments inside 14 days of beginning.
